- baseline shift
The process of raising or lowering text characters to control positioning or alignment in a design. A positive baseline shift value raises the text, while a negative value lowers it, as calculated from the initial baseline positioning. - bicubic
An interpolation method that delivers the highest quality results when enlarging an image. Other interpolation methods are bilinear and Nearest Neighbor. - blending modes
Preset functions that compare a source image with new data such as a separate layer or paint tool. Blending modes compare and combine these two sets of pixel data to create unique imaging effects. - border
The outlined edge of a path or selection. Borders can be selected independently and can be filled and stroked. |
